Introduction
Aims and Scopes
- Hernia Repair Techniques:
The journal extensively covers various surgical techniques for hernia repair, including minimally invasive approaches such as laparoscopic and endoscopic methods, highlighting advancements and comparative outcomes. - Clinical Outcomes and Risk Factors:
Research focusing on the clinical outcomes of different hernia surgeries, including morbidity and recurrence rates, as well as identifying risk factors that influence surgical success, is a key area of interest. - Historical Perspectives in Surgery:
The journal includes historical reviews of surgical practices and advancements, providing context for current methods and techniques in hernia repair. - Innovative Surgical Approaches:
It explores novel surgical strategies and techniques, such as the use of new materials and technologies in hernia repair, aiming to improve patient outcomes. - Multidisciplinary Approaches:
The publication emphasizes the importance of a multidisciplinary approach to hernia management, integrating perspectives from various medical disciplines to enhance patient care.
Trending and Emerging
- Endoscopic and Minimally Invasive Techniques:
There is a notable increase in research on endoscopic and minimally invasive techniques for hernia repair, reflecting a trend towards less invasive procedures that promise quicker recovery and reduced complications. - Complex Hernia Management:
Emerging themes around the management of complex hernias, including those with significant complications or co-morbidities, indicate a growing interest in tailored surgical approaches. - Patient-Centered Outcomes and Quality of Life:
Recent studies emphasize the importance of patient-reported outcomes and quality of life following hernia surgery, highlighting a movement towards more holistic patient care. - Use of New Materials and Technologies:
The exploration of innovative materials and technologies in hernia repair, such as bioengineered meshes and robotics, is gaining traction in recent publications. - Historical and Cultural Context in Surgery:
An emerging interest in the historical and cultural aspects of hernia surgery, particularly within Latin America, is evident, reflecting a broader understanding of the field's evolution.
Declining or Waning
- Traditional Open Surgery Techniques:
There appears to be a waning focus on traditional open surgical techniques for hernia repair, as the field increasingly shifts towards minimally invasive procedures. - Basic Anatomical Studies:
While foundational anatomical studies are important, their frequency in recent publications has decreased, possibly due to a preference for applied surgical research and clinical outcomes. - Generalist Approaches to Hernia Management:
The journal seems to be moving away from generalist discussions on hernia management, favoring more specialized and advanced topics that cater to specific types of hernias. - Historical Reviews of Non-surgical Treatments:
There has been a reduced emphasis on non-surgical management strategies for hernias, as the focus shifts towards surgical interventions that demonstrate more definitive outcomes. - Basic Education and Training in Hernia Surgery:
The themes related to basic training and educational resources for new surgeons have declined, suggesting a shift towards more advanced discussions and research.
